How Does Blogs Help?

How does blog contribute to your reflection on your study or learning in this course? That was also one of the questions that the interviewer, Mr. Too Wei Keong asked me regarding blogs in learning. In my opinion, it helps a great deal in helping students’ to reflect on their learning process.

The main reason of why blog helps students to reflect on their study is because of the academic purpose of its creation – to be treated as a journal, where students write and comment on what they have learnt in the lectures or tutorials. Inevitably, this will lead students to reflect on what they had been taught. In other words, it also helps in improving students’ reflective skills.

Besides that, students can also refer to the blogs of their course mates to know or recall back what they had missed in the lectures due to some reasons, such as absent, lack of attention and slip of memory.

Last but not the least, blog provides a conducive, stress-free environment, where students can freely express their thoughts and doubts that they are too shy or fear to voice out in the lectures. Thus, it may also serves as a forum to discuss about what they had learnt, as students comment on the blogs of their course mates.

In conclusion, blogs are very useful in the learning process. Besides helping students to reflect on their learning process, students become more motivated when they had a clearer picture on what they are learning, as well as the use of the knowledge they had learnt. Once they understand that what they are learning will be useful in the future, they will become more inquisitive, hardworking and attentive in the lectures and tutorials.
